Proxy not defined errors in IE11

Open mcsmcs opened this issue 6 years ago • 1 comments

We leverage storybook, webdriver, and saucelabs to do visual regression testing. Recently, probably on a bump of theme-context or dependent components, we started getting errors when we run IE tests that have @hig/[email protected] rendered.

The error is: Proxy is undefined

It looks like the Proxy feature is leveraged here: https://github.com/Autodesk/hig/blob/development/packages/theme-context/src/ThemeContext/createThemeProxy.js#L12

Unfortunately they're not supported in IE11: https://developer.mozilla.org/en-US/docs/Web/JavaScript/Reference/Global_Objects/Proxy#Browser_compatibility

I'll try some runs with NODE_ENV === 'production' from here

But this could put other things into production mode (build tools) that aren't necessary, slowing down our tests. If the above works, can we consider leveraging a different environment variable (e.g. HIG_ENV)?
